In1995 Granny’s Favourite (or abbreviated: Granny's) was created by a few guys with a mind of their own and therefore the determination to make their own music. Today, the band has five members, each with a different taste in music. Guitar is the main ingredient in the music of Granny’s, but the influences are diverse. Electronic sounds and a Turkish saz are part of the sound as well. In combination with the different tastes in music of the band members this results in a musical melting pot. Although the music is hard to categorize, the press has been enthusiastic. For instance, a local newspaper based in Rotterdam even stated that: “ Darryl Ann and Granny’s Favourite played the stars out of the sky. ” Well, that may be a literally translated Dutch expression, but it is clear what it means. Summer 2003 gave birth to a new CD, titled: Girls, Cars and Artificial Light. The five songs on the cd were recorded in four days. Comparisons with other bands by listeners are: Radiohead, U2, The Doors, Zita Swoon and Coldplay.
